Restaurant is located on juhu tara road opposite juhu beach. However sea view is blocked due to few construction projects.

Well known for gujarati/marwadi/rajasthani thali.

Pros: good food, decent ambience, quick service, polite & attentive staff. Paan served at the end of the meal was superb. So was the saffron infused/flavoured welcome drink. Undhiyu and desserts were prepared nicely. Instead of daal bati churma they served daal pakwan. At their malad outlet which i had been to few months back, they had served daal dhokli. Both these dishes were not authentic but were freshly made and tasted great. The server brings both sweet as well as spicy daal & kadhi together so wait time is reduced.

Cons: very expensive thali, mis- match between pricing and offering. Inspite of charging a bomb, the thali price does not include bottled water (bisleri/aquafina). Food was tasty but menu was not that great. On a sunday afternoon they served dry potato bhaji, chhole & gravy paneer in a thali which costs approx rs 800/-. The potato bhaji was of the type one prepares when there is nothing else available in the kitchen but something needs to be put up on the table quickly.

They take kid friendliness too seriously. The kids occupying the table behind me were creating a ruckus but none of the wait staff requested either the kids to calm down or requested the adults who accompanied them to look after those kids. If you don't want to tell the guests directly then atleast display a notice prominently in the restaurant asking parents to control kids in case they get too noisy or unruly.

Finally, please dont serve potato bhaji and bengali sweet in a gujarati/rajasthani thali. You are cutting corners after charging a bomb from the customer.

When it comes to Unlimited Thali Rajashthani & Gujrati food MAHARAJA bhog pops in my mind on top!!

This place is located Very much nearby to Juhu beach which makes it super easy to locate.

We went there during weekdays Lunch time and It was almost full keeping covid guidelines which was the best and safe part.

Food varities here is the USP of this place and It was too much!

They have unlimited thali options and during our visit

Starters: Khaman dhokla and Batata vada was served and It was one softest, spongy Khaman dhokla i had and chutney were like cherry on the cake.

Batata vada was also extremely flavourful.

In Mains: Varities were too much Paneer jalfrezy: This was the best out of all and succulent paneer cubes with medium spicy gravy was enough to satisfy my tastebuds.

Aalloo mutter: This was again perfectly cooked and flavours were bursting all over.

Rajashthani gatte ki sabji: Gatta was soft and fresh and gravy was a bit salty as per my taste so It was okies for me.

Dal baati churma: I loved every bite of this, The baati were crisp to perfection and flavour of dal was subtle and they topped it with tons of ghee so nothing like it and I am a big churma Fan and they didn't disappoint me here.

Rice, Khichdi, Sevai onion pulao,:

Their pulao was the mind blowing and almost like Biryani because of spices. It was the perfect combination with boondi raitha and I cherished every bite of it.

Aamras : This was the highlight of my visit and I couldn't count how many bowl I slurpped during my entire Lunch and It was heavenly!!

There were some more dessert options they had and were Too yumm to handle.

The menu keeps on changing and best time to visit them Is during mango season!!

If you love Rajasthani food & thalis, I bet, Maharaja Bhog is one of the finest dining experiences you'll ever have! With quaint ambience, soothing Indian music & courteous and homely staff, this place is definitely the one you should visit in Mumbai. Here's what I loved about the thali here: The very first thing is they give a super royal treatment! There's welcome drink to begin with i.e. aam panna. Then they started with small sides like chatpata chana, lemon slice, chutneys. - Ring dhokla: Was yummy and a bit on the sweeter side, with coconut chutney on the top! - Rajasthani mirchiwada: Superb! Mirchi stuffed with Rajasthani masala for that zingy taste! - Daal baati: Crunchy baati with a little spicy yet supeeeer delish dal with ghee on top is the best thing you'll have here. Don't forget the churma which is the perfect amount of crumbly sweet affair! - There were 4 sabzi's overall, which were: one green sabzi, paneer sabzi, aloo tamatar ki sabzi & gatte ki sabzi. - 5 types of fulkas topped with makkhan & jaggery. YUMMMM! - Kadhi & Dal, 2 types each, sweet & spicy. Both were supeeeerbbbbb! - Crunchy papad - Gheewar was legit dropping gheeeee and it was sooooo amazing! Best thing ever - Basundi was just the right amount of sweet. Sluuurpppp - There was a halwa which was best of all, which I couldn't remember the name. It was made up of tonssss of ghee & carrot. - 2 types of rice, one was flavored & other was plain. Great ending to an amazing meal. - How can we forget desserts? There was a meetha paan reserved for your taste buds! - Not to forget, the buttermilk was kickass! I legit had multiple refills :p Overall, my experience over here was totally worth it! Amazing food, nice ambience, homely staff & royal treatment. What else do we need! :D

Maharaja Bhog. "Eat breakfast like a king, lunch like a prince and dinner like a pauper. Whoever you are, you deserve to have a royal meal " Maharaja in English means the king and Maharaja bhog certainly lives up to it's brand name, serving and treating their guest nothing less than a Maharaja or Maharani. I have been a regular dinner at this outlet located near the Juhu beach. Maharaja Bhog as a brand has always been the Kapoor khaandans favorite place as and when they want to enjoy a proper Rajasthani thali. My mom loves this place to the extent that whenever anyone says " let's go out to eat " she instantly replies " Let's go to Maharaja Bhog and have the thali ". So I recently visited Maharaja Bhog with my mom, The Manager Bhavesh Singh welcomed me with a bright smile on his face. That was a perfect start to the meal. As soon as you settle down you first have to wash your hands and then the empty thali comes to your table. Then one by one you are served food in small quantity so that you each hot food. The menu is different everyday. The menu when I went was as follows First you are served with farsan. - Hara Bhara Tikki - Sandwich Dhokla - Dal Pakwan Tadka. Then you are served with 4 different vegetables. - Palak Corn Paneer - Kaju Kanda Karela - Aloo Goanese - Moong Muthiya. Two types of Dal/Kadhi - Rajathani Dal / kadhi - Gujrati Dal / kadhi Three different types of Roti - Fulka - Mix Veg Paneer Paratha - Plain Puri. Rice - Steam Rice - Khichdi. Sweets - Chawali Dal Halwa - Rose Basundi. I would like to thank everyone who hosted me at Maharaja Bhog and I would also like to thank the founder Ashish Maheshwari for a lovely meal.
